About the Financial Clerks, All Other role

Financial clerks in India handle the essential administrative tasks required to maintain accurate financial records across various industries. This career suits individuals with strong numerical aptitude and attention to detail who wish to work in banking, government offices, or corporate finance departments. They play a vital role in the Indian economy by ensuring the smooth processing of transactions, tax compliance, and financial documentation.

Skills required

  • Attention to Detail and Accuracy
  • Accounts Payable and Receivable Processing
  • Data Entry and Spreadsheet Management (MS Excel)
  • Knowledge of Indian GST and TDS Regulations
  • Proficiency in Tally ERP or SAP FICO
  • Time Management and Deadline Adherence
  • Professional Communication in English and Hindi
  • Basic Financial Reporting
  • Document Archiving and Record Keeping
  • Bank Reconciliation Procedures

How to enter this career

  1. 01

    Complete a Bachelor's degree in Commerce (B.Com) or Business Administration (BBA) from a recognized university.

  2. 02

    Pursue a Diploma in Banking and Finance or a certification in Tally and MS Excel to gain technical skills.

  3. 03

    Apply for entry-level clerical positions in private firms or clear government exams like IBPS Clerk for public sector roles.

A day in the life

  • 9:30 AM - Reviewing daily transaction logs and reconciling discrepancies in the ledger.
  • 11:30 AM - Processing specialized financial documents such as credit applications or insurance claims.
  • 1:30 PM - Coordinating with the accounts department to verify vendor payment status.
  • 3:30 PM - Updating internal databases with new financial data and generating status reports.
  • 5:30 PM - Finalizing the day's documentation and filing records for audit compliance.
